DAY 1 - Tues, Sept 16
500M TIME TRIAL & KILO
Scott, Blyth and Chisholm on the 500TT podium
Two of the GB Team's recent successes at the European Championships, Anna Blyth and Matt Crampton were the stars of the show on the opening night of the 2008 National Senior Track Championships.
Anna Blyth gets off the line in aggressive style
Blyth was an extremely comfortable winner in the 500m Time Trial, going off last and demolishing the second best time of Helen Scott of Healsowen to the tune of almost a second and a half. Alison Chisholm of Edinburgh RC was third.
Helen Scott, who took the silver medal in the 500m TT
In the Men's Kilo, there was an altogether tougher task facing Crampton. He knew that amongst the riders going off before him were former national record holder, Craig MacLean, and young gun sprinters Christian Lyte and David Daniell.
However, there was a turn up when Olympic Pursuit bronze medallist Steven Burke signed on to ride. Burke had surprised many with his time of 1:03.080 during the Omnium event at the World Track Championships back in March and he duly repeated the dose, with a time of 1.03.764, another good effort on a night when the track looked to be running slow.
Steven Burke - endurance rider or sprinter?
Craig MacLean looked short of racing, producing a time of 1.04.818. Of the young riders who have made such an impact at Junior and Under-23 level in recent years, David Daniell got closest to Burke's time with 1.03.928.
Crampton really had to hurt himself to beat Burke
And so it was left to Matt Crampton to claim the title which, on paper, he should have won with ease. At the worlds he just missed out on a medal with 1:01.822 but this time he looked to be struggling and although he held on to win in 1.03.103, the effort told on him and it was a good 20 minutes after he'd climbed off his bike before he was in a fit state to pick up his medal. Burke finished with the silver and Daniell with the bronze.
